Hi, new member here hoping to get some advice from actual owners. I am looking at a 1995 29 open. Spoke with the seller and I was told on a previous survey moisture was found on both hull sides and deck . Should I run away? or hire my own surveyor and see just how bad it is? Also any other problem areas i should look for shopping around. Thanks in advance.

Hello,
I own a 1999 -2900 open. I'm surprised to hear that the side hull has any water. I suggest seeing if you can read the old survey. Keep in mind all boat have some type of water intrusion, just how much is what matters. If you cannot get old survey, maybe purchase a meter before you hire inspector.
I'd look at transom and strings where engine mounts. By the way, engine compartment is extremely tight and this can drive up repair cost (might need a hard helmet-lol) above the deck steps starboard side can sometimes get water in from the horn. If there an inspection hatch open it up.
The overall boat is a beast ( great lakes for me) but can take some spray over bow. If you have any specific question let me know - good luck
